Why is this a great opportunity?
Procurement Coordinator Level III is responsible for performing sourcing activities on large industrial capital projects. Procurement Coordinator Level II’s are assigned to sourcing events for standard and medium criticality materials, equipment, and subcontracts. They also support complex purchasing activities for more complex materials, equipment and subcontracts within the realm of the Procurement Coordinator III position, as needed.

What you’ll do as a Procurement Coordinator II:
  • Responsible for execution (purchase) of Early Procurement pre-mobilization checklist items
  • Responsible for sourcing activities for both estimating support on projects in the Deal Development phase and Procurement Execution activities during the life cycle of a project from RFP solicitations through the Award phase
  • Perform commercial analyses of Bidders proposals, conduct supplier negotiations, writing and submitting recommendations of award and leading Bidder conferences
  • Engaging and maintaining Supplier relationships on awarded contracts, communicating with key internal and external stakeholders and maintaining overall transparency with the Project Management Team (PMT)
  • Participation in Deal Development and support in estimating efforts including issuing Request for Information (RFI’s)
  • Perform evaluation of proposals and coordinate discussions between bidders and technical personnel
  • Maintain an understanding of the standard contract terms and conditions and contract formation
  • Negotiate with suppliers to obtain the overall best deal and risk profile for the enterprise
  • Participate in Supplier and subcontractor kick-off and close-out meetings
  • Develop scopes of work and negotiate contract change orders and amendments
  • Maintain knowledge in specific IT support systems (Oracle, PPMS, Document Control)
  • Participate in weekly procurement meeting
  • Develop and maintain strong relationships with suppliers, engineers, construction management, and essential project personnel
  • Manage workload efficiently in a fast-paced environment focused on standard complex technical items with opportunities towards more complex high-profile items as experienced is gained and stronger skills are demonstrated
  • Lead in procurement execution for standard and medium criticality sourcing events, conduct research & development sourcing strategies, develop supplier list and sourcing strategies, as well as performance-based scopes of work and understand specifications and drawing packages from RFP through the Award phase
  • Deal Development phase estimating support from receipt of proposal through proposal submittal
  • Maintain knowledge of procurement processes and procedures and execute in accordance with Zachry SOP’s
  • Interface and manage relationships with Suppliers, Engineering, and Construction Management personnel
  • Travel to project site as needed to participate in Supplier kick-off, closeout and clarification meetings (15% or less)
  • Other duties as assigned
